Core Web Vitals sú tri kľúčové metriky, ktorými Google meria používateľský zážitok webov — a podľa ktorých rozhoduje aj o pozíciách vo vyhľadávaní. Pozrime sa na každú zvlášť.
LCP — Largest Contentful Paint
Meria, ako dlho trvá, kým sa zobrazí hlavný viditeľný prvok stránky — typicky veľký obrázok alebo nadpis. Cieľ: pod 2.5 sekundy.
Ako optimalizovať LCP
- Optimalizácia obrázkov (WebP, AVIF, lazy loading)
- Preload kritických zdrojov
- CDN pre statické súbory
- Vykresľovanie na serveri tam, kde je to možné
CLS — Cumulative Layout Shift
Meria, ako veľmi sa posúva obsah počas načítania. Predstavte si, že chcete kliknúť na tlačidlo a v tom momente sa objaví reklama, ktorá obsah posunie. Cieľ: pod 0.1.
Ako optimalizovať CLS
- Vždy uvádzajte
widthaheightna obrázkoch - Rezervujte miesto pre dynamický obsah
- Vyhýbajte sa vkladaniu obsahu nad existujúci
- Používajte
font-display: swappri webových fontoch
INP — Interaction to Next Paint
Nahradila staršiu metriku FID v marci 2024. Meria responzívnosť na používateľské akcie — kliknutie, klávesnica, dotyk. Cieľ: pod 200 ms.
Ako optimalizovať INP
- Minimalizovať JavaScript, ktorý beží počas interakcie
- Rozdeliť dlhé úlohy na menšie
- Používať
requestIdleCallback - Odložené načítanie nepodstatných komponentov
Ako merať Core Web Vitals
Najjednoduchšie cez PageSpeed Insights (pagespeed.web.dev). Pre detailnejší pohľad použite Chrome DevTools — Lighthouse audit alebo Performance panel. V produkcii je dobré mať real-user monitoring (RUM) napr. cez Web Vitals JS knižnicu.
Záver
Core Web Vitals nie sú len Google ranking faktor — sú reálnym ukazovateľom kvality používateľského zážitku. Ich optimalizácia je investícia, ktorá sa vráti nielen v lepších SEO pozíciách, ale aj vo vyšších konverziách.